Highlighted claims
- The intervention is delivered through an open information website and a password-protected eHealth platform. — Study protocol of the e-Intervention Enhancing Mental Health in Adolescents (IMPROVA) project: a randomised controlled trial to promote adolescents’ mental health and well-being in four European countries
- The intervention uses SEL, CBT strategies, Self-Determination Theory, and Persuasive System Design as frameworks. — Study protocol of the e-Intervention Enhancing Mental Health in Adolescents (IMPROVA) project: a randomised controlled trial to promote adolescents’ mental health and well-being in four European countries
- The adolescent intervention includes 22 topic-specific modules delivered in a defined sequence. — Study protocol of the e-Intervention Enhancing Mental Health in Adolescents (IMPROVA) project: a randomised controlled trial to promote adolescents’ mental health and well-being in four European countries
- IMPROVA combines SEL, CBT, and digital scalability in a multi-level platform. — Study protocol of the e-Intervention Enhancing Mental Health in Adolescents (IMPROVA) project: a randomised controlled trial to promote adolescents’ mental health and well-being in four European countries
- Disorder-specific content was excluded to avoid supervision requirements, reduce stigma, improve acceptability, and support scalability. — Study protocol of the e-Intervention Enhancing Mental Health in Adolescents (IMPROVA) project: a randomised controlled trial to promote adolescents’ mental health and well-being in four European countries
- School staff receive modules for self-care, supporting students, and tutoring sessions. — Study protocol of the e-Intervention Enhancing Mental Health in Adolescents (IMPROVA) project: a randomised controlled trial to promote adolescents’ mental health and well-being in four European countries
